THINGS YOU WILL DO…-
Champion procurement activities in a busy food production environment.
-
Maintain optimal inventory levels, manage material requirements and associated logistics.
-
Source food ingredients and packaging ensuring items purchased follow established policies and procedures.
-
Troubleshoot with internal and external stakeholders on resolving issues such as pricing, delays, deliveries, quality and inventory.
-
Negotiate and track contracts with suppliers providing analytical data and reports to support.
-
May on occasion work at various times including weekends, as the job requires.
-
Ability to travel as needed to visit suppliers and attend industry events
